Suchorzewko [suxɔˈʐɛfkɔ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Jaraczewo, within Jarocin County, Greater Poland Voivodeship, in west-central Poland.[1] It lies approximately 10 kilometres (6 mi) south-east of Jaraczewo, 11 km (7 mi) south-west of Jarocin, and 64 km (40 mi) south-east of the regional capital Poznań.
